Tinto Brass, a master of the erotic art film, directs with his signature visual style, characterized by his adoration of the female form, particularly the posterior. The film features overexposed, sunlit Italian plazas and brightly lit interiors that require a high bitrate to avoid washing out.

Cinematographer Massimo Di Venosa employs lingering close-ups and wide, voyeuristic shots that rely on sharp detail. The 1080p transfer captures the subtle expressions on Jimskaia’s face—a flicker of shame, a burst of liberated joy—that lesser formats miss. Many niche, international, or cult films fail to secure mainstream streaming distribution due to regional licensing restrictions, censorship, or a lack of commercial interest from major platforms. In the case of explicit erotica or foreign arthouse films, physical discs often go out of print, making them incredibly rare and expensive on the secondary market.
